Output e094d10183b7b767a452f35fc5b19dff17cd54b2b4922cf478c18692d5ba2615:0

value
12021382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83b111d14dadb6cd95f398c13acf1a91a067eec9 OP_EQUAL
address
3DhLZgghNz1T5FFLAdSKV5mGjTdKbA56rC
transaction
e094d10183b7b767a452f35fc5b19dff17cd54b2b4922cf478c18692d5ba2615
confirmations
296855
spent
true